Basic Requirement for the Share Market Investment:
- First you have to open the "SAVING ACCOUNT".
- Then you link the Saving Bank Account to "DEMAT ACCOUNT".
- Finally open the "TRADING ACCOUNT"(It will help to Buy or Sell your shares)
- This three accounts are open with the help of the "STOCK BROKER".
